We are seeking an enthusiastic and motivated PE Teacher to join a thriving secondary school in Dewsbury. The successful candidate will deliver engaging Physical Education lessons across Key Stages 3 and 4, inspiring students to develop confidence, teamwork, resilience, and a lifelong commitment to healthy, active lifestyles. The role includes contributing to extracurricular sports clubs, fixtures, and wider school activities while maintaining high standards of teaching, learning, and behaviour.
Key Responsibilities
- Plan and deliver high-quality PE lessons across the curriculum.
- Assess, monitor, and support student progress and achievement.
- Promote participation, sportsmanship, and physical wellbeing.
- Create a safe, inclusive, and positive learning environment.
- Support and lead extracurricular sports activities and school competitions.
- Work collaboratively with colleagues, parents, and the wider school community.
The Ideal Candidate Will Have
-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ent.
- Strong subject knowledge and a passion for Physical Education.
- Excellent classroom and behaviour management skills.
- The ability to motivate and engage students of all abilities.
- A commitment to safeguarding and promoting student welfare.
- Up-to-date DBS checks including safeguarding training.
This is an exciting opportunity to join a supportive school environment and make a positive impact on students’ academic, physical, and personal development. We welcome applications from both experienced teachers and Early Career Teachers (ECTs).
